usurp

英 [juːˈzɜːp]

美 [juːˈzɜːrp]

v.  篡夺; 侵权

过去分词:usurped 现在分词:usurping 过去式:usurped 第三人称单数:usurps 

GRETEM8

Collins.1 / BNC.14267 / COCA.15488

牛津词典

    verb

    • 篡夺;侵权
      to take sb's position and/or power without having the right to do this

      柯林斯词典

      • VERB 夺取;篡夺;侵占
        If you say that someoneusurpsa job, role, title, or position, they take it from someone when they have no right to do this.
        1. Did she usurp his place in his mother's heart?...
          她取代了他在他母亲心目中的地位吗?
        2. The Congress wants to reverse the reforms and usurp the power of the presidency.
          议会企图颠覆改革,夺取总统权力。

      英英释义

      verb

      • seize and take control without authority and possibly with force
        1. He assumed to himself the right to fill all positions in the town
        2. he usurped my rights
        3. She seized control of the throne after her husband died
        Synonym:assumeseizetake overarrogate
      • take the place of
        1. gloom had usurped mirth at the party after the news of the terrorist act broke
